CAPTAIN ROBERT H. GORMLEY Captain Robert H. Gormley relieved Captain Brenner as Commanding Officer of WHITE PLAINS on December IO. 1969. in the Sea of japan. Captain GOfrDlCy's last assignment prior to WHITE PLAINS was with Commander Attack Carrier Striking Force Seventh Fleet CTask Force 77D where he served as Assistant Chief of Staff for Operations and Plans. Prior to that he was assigned to the Office of the Assistant Secretary of Defense CSystems Analysisj in Washington, D.C. Captain Gormley was born in Ventura, California, and attended elementary and secondary schools in California. While a student at the University of Texas, he received an appointment to the U.S. Naval Academy and was graduated in 1947. Following commissioning he served in the destroyer PUTNAM in the Atlantic Fleet. Subsequent to being designated a Naval Aviator in 1950, Captain Gormley served in a variety of assignments: carrier-based anti-submarine and fighter squadrons, jet training units, and on the staffs of the Commanders of Carrier Division Seventeen, the Operational Test and Evaluation Force and the Atlantic Fleet's training air group. In 1965 Captain Gormley assumed Command of Fighter Squadron Forty-One. Under his command the squadron, flying the F-4B Phantom II jet fighter-bomber, deployed to Southeast Asia on board the Attack Carrier INDEPENDENCE for combat air operations against North Vietnam. Sub- sequently Captain Gormley became Commander Attack Carrier Air Wing Seven in INDEPENDENCE. Captain Gormley has studied at both the Naval War College and Harvard University and received a Master's Degree from Harvard in 1963. Captain Gormley's personal decorations include the Distinguished Flying Cross and the Bronze Star.
